Factors Affecting the Cost of Brick Walls Several variables contribute to the overall cost of building brick walls, and understanding them will help you make an informed decision. Material Costs Traditional Bricks: Traditional bricks are made from materials such as clay, which undergo a firing process. Depending on the quality and type of bricks, prices can vary significantly. High-quality clay bricks may cost anywhere from ₹5 to ₹10 per brick in India, and this can add up quickly for large-scale projects. Brick Tiles: An excellent alternative to traditional bricks is brick tiles, which are thinner and more cost-effective. Brick tiles offer the same aesthetic appeal as full-sized bricks but are less expensive because they require fewer raw materials and are easier to install. On average, brick tiles can cost between ₹30 and ₹70 per square foot, depending on their quality and design.

Energy Efficiency Brick walls offer excellent thermal insulation, which can help reduce heating and cooling costs. Bricks absorb and slowly release heat, helping to maintain a stable indoor temperature. Over time, this energy efficiency can lead to significant savings on utility bills, adding to the overall value of brick walls. Comparing Brick Walls to Other Materials When considering whether brick walls are expensive, it’s essential to compare them with other popular wall materials. Concrete Concrete is a cheaper alternative to bricks in terms of initial cost, but it may not offer the same aesthetic or thermal benefits. Additionally, concrete walls are more prone to cracking and may require repairs over time, which can increase long-term costs. Wood Wood is another popular material for walls, particularly for interior spaces. While wood can be less expensive upfront, it requires more maintenance than brick and is susceptible to moisture, termites, and fire. This increases the overall cost of maintaining wood walls. Drywall Drywall is a common choice for interior walls due to its affordability and ease of installation. However, drywall is not as durable as brick or brick tiles and is prone to damage from moisture, dents, and wear. Over time, the need for repairs or replacements can make drywall more expensive than bricks in the long run.
